## Changelog — Quillforge v2.8.1

This release rotates the signing key used by the Quillforge template pipeline at Brindlemark Systems. The rotation coincides with our new precompiled template cache, which cut median render times from 140ms to 38ms. Because cached templates are now signed at build time, every node must trust the new key before rollout; otherwise renders fall back to the slow interpreted path. Please read the rollout order in the deploy doc carefully before touching staging. The new signing key is as follows.

release key, fahaf-bajof: bky3_Xam

INTERNAL MEMO — To the incoming Director of Commercial Operations, Brightfall Logistics. Our discount policy for large deals: any contract above the annual threshold requires dual sign-off, a floor of 22% gross margin, and no multi-year price locks without indexation. Regional leads may approve up to 10% off list; beyond that, escalation to you. Historic exceptions are logged in the deal register. The policy's rationale connects to plans summarized below.

confidential, kagep-kahof: Druokax Systems plans to lower the Ulaath list price by 53 percent in March.

**Ticket: Markdown pipeline connection failures**

The Inkmill rendering workers are intermittently failing to reach the snippets database during peak renders, producing blank previews. Retries mask it but latency spikes. Suspect pool exhaustion rather than network. Reviewer: please check the pooling settings in the worker config against the database we connect to with the string below.

primary connection of tajeg-tajop = postgresql://julax_svc:DI@db-e7f3.kelvidyn.corp:5432/rusdor

**Ticket SQ-77 — Weather-alert fan-out pointing at wrong region**

Note for new team members: the Stormlark fan-out service in staging was dispatching alerts to the decommissioned east cluster because `FANOUT_REGION` was never updated. Fix: set it to `north-2` and restart the dispatcher. The dispatcher also needs its publish credential, which goes in the env file immediately after the region setting.

env line for fafof-fahag: LEDGER_TOKEN5=f8790